The consumption of energy by 60-watt bulb in 2 seconds is:
A
20 J
B
30 J
C
120 J
D
0.02 J
Tap any option to test your recall and reveal the step-by-step Propolis autopsy.

Propolis Cognitive Error Autopsy

Official Correct Choice:
Option C: 120 J
Concept:

Energy consumption is the product of the power of the device and the time it operates.

Formula:

$$ E = P \times t $$

Solution:

  • Given Power (\( P \)) = 60 W (which is 60 Joules/second)


  • Given Time (\( t \)) = 2 s


  • \( E = 60 \text{ J/s} \times 2 \text{ s} = 120 \text{ J} \)


Why other options are incorrect:

Dividing power by time (60/2) gives 30 J (Option B). Other options arise from incorrect arithmetic manipulation of the given numbers.
